Koze Red Light Therapy Reviews: Do They Really Work?

Koze red light therapy reviews highlight improved skin tone, faster muscle recovery, and reduced joint discomfort. Many users describe the treatment as relaxing, with noticeable changes after consistent sessions at home.

Advancements in LED technology have made red light panels more compact and affordable. Koze devices appeal to people seeking drug-free options for minor pain, aging skin, and workout recovery.

At-Home Treatment Experience

Koze red light therapy reviews frequently mention the convenience of at-home sessions. Users describe lying back under the panel while reading or listening to music. The quiet operation and gentle warmth contribute to a spa-like routine without clinic visits.

Treatment times are typically short, often 10 to 20 minutes per session. People appreciate the ability to schedule sessions around work, family, and travel. This flexibility supports consistent use, which many reviewers link to better outcomes.

Skin Health and Anti-Aging Results

Visible Skin Improvements

Reviewers note smoother texture, reduced fine lines, and a more even complexion. Collagen stimulation is frequently mentioned as the biological mechanism behind these skin benefits. Consistent use appears to enhance results over several weeks.

Compatibility with Skincare Routines

Many users combine red light therapy with serums and moisturizers for enhanced absorption. Koze panels cover the face and neck comfortably, allowing multitreatment. This integration fits naturally into existing self-care rituals.

Muscle Recovery and Pain Relief

Post-Workout and Injury Support

Athletes and weekend exercisers report reduced soreness after using Koze panels on shoulders, knees, and lower back. Some describe faster return to training schedules. The near-infrared spectrum is often credited for deeper tissue penetration.

Joint Stiffness and Chronic Conditions

Reviewers with mild arthritis and long-term stiffness mention improved mobility and less morning stiffness. Koze devices are commonly used before physiotherapy sessions to prepare tissues. Individual results vary, and medical guidance is recommended for serious conditions.

Design, Safety, and Daily Use

Koze units emphasize compact designs, adjustable stands, and intuitive control panels. Thermal sensors and automatic shutoff features add confidence for unsupervised use. Many appreciate the low blue light emission, which supports evening sessions without sleep disruption.

Customers note that the lightweight panels are easy to reposition between rooms. Storage is straightforward, with minimal cable management concerns. These practical details influence long-term satisfaction and daily adherence to routines.

How long does it take to see results with Koze red light therapy?

Some users report subtle improvements within two weeks, while noticeable skin or pain changes often appear after four to six weeks of consistent sessions. Frequency and individual biology affect timing.

Can Koze panels replace professional dermatology or physiotherapy treatments?

Koze devices are wellness tools, not medical replacements. Users describe them as complementary to professional care, with severe conditions requiring a healthcare provider.

Are Koze red light therapy panels safe for daily use at home?

Many reviewers use Koze panels daily for short sessions without issues. Built-in safety features like automatic shutoff and thermal protection help reduce risk when instructions are followed.

Do Koze travel models perform as well as larger home panels?

Travel models deliver noticeable benefits, though coverage area is smaller. Reviewers find them convenient for maintaining routine while traveling or at the office.
